The City of Edmonds requires all businesses operating within the City limits, including property owners, home-based businesses, and all contractors, to obtain a business license prior to commencing business operations.  Please see Chapter 4.72.020  for specific requirements.

In May 2019, the City of Edmonds partnered with the State of Washington Business Licensing Service (BLS)  to connect our business license application and renewal process to the State BLS system.  What this means is all applications and renewals of City business licenses will be processed through the BLS system on the Department of Revenue website.  The City of Edmonds no longer accepts business license applications or fees at City Hall.

To get started please go to dor.wa.gov/MyDOR .  You will need to sign up for a Secure Access Washington User ID if you do not already have one.  All fees for City Business Licenses are collected by the DOR.  Once an application is completed and the City is notified of a pending application, we will reach out to the business to request more specific information about the business.  Providing an up-to-date email address that is checked regularly will ensure the business license is processed as quickly as possible.  At any time during the application process you may check the status of your business license application by logging into your MyDOR account.  Once it is approved, the status will change from pending to active.  DOR will mail a copy of the new license to the business once it has been approved by the City.

Change of Address
If you need to update your business address please do so by logging into your DOR account and changing the information there.  The City of Edmonds cannot change the address information in the DOR system.

Types of Business Licenses

General (commercial) business
Application Fee -- $125
Annual Renewal Fee -- $50

Any business operating in a commercial space should apply for a General Business License. Along with a Business License Application filed with the Department of Revenue, a commercial business must return a floor plan and a completed business license questionnaire to the City of Edmonds. The City of Edmonds will contact the business by email or letter as soon as their application has been received from the DOR to provide the business with the form that requires completion. Until those documents are submitted, the City of Edmonds endorsement cannot be approved. Home business Application Fee -- $100
Annual Renewal Fee -- $50

Any business operating out of a home in the City of Edmonds should apply for a Home Occupation License.  This includes those businesses that may conduct work outside of the home, such as a construction or house cleaning business, but use their home strictly as a mailing address or home office.   Along with a Business License Application filed with the Department of Revenue, a home occupation questionnaire must be submitted to the City of Edmonds. Non-Resident business
Application Fee -- $50
Annual Renewal Fee -- $50

If a business is physically located outside the Edmonds City Limits, but conducts business within the City, a Non-Resident business license is required.  However, per Chapter 4.72.021 there is a threshold exemption.  If a Non-Resident business whose annual value of products, gross proceeds of sales, or gross income of the business in the city is equal to or less than $12,000, a Non-Resident business license is not required.  The exemption does not apply to regulatory license requirements or activities that require a specialized permit.

A Business License Application must be filed with the Department of Revenue.  Once the fee is paid, the Non-Resident license is automatically approved. If the business applying needs to apply for a City of Edmonds permit with the Planning and Development Department the same day, please keep a copy of the business license receipt and make note of your UBI Number (this is your business license number).  You will provide these two things to the Planning and Development Department to show proof of city business license.  After 24-48 hours of a completed application on DOR, City of Edmonds staff will be able to look the business up on DOR to verify the license.  

Non-Profit Business

Application Fee -- $0
Annual Renewal Fee -- $0

While non-profit businesses are exempt from the application and renewal fees, they are still required to obtain a City of Edmonds Business License and go through the application process.  An application must be filed with the Department of Revenue.  If DOR does not have the business listed as a non-profit already, the business will want to call DOR at 360-705-6741 to discuss with them how to provide them with proof of non-profit status.  The business must be listed as non-profit with DOR before completing the application in order for the fees to be exempted.  

Along with a Business License Application filed with the Department of Revenue, a non-profit business must submit a floor plan and a completed business license questionnaire or a home occupation questionnaire depending on the type of business the non-profit is. Until those documents are submitted, the City of Edmonds endorsement cannot be approved.
